To reduce the fluctuations of tobacco flow and moisture content in cut tobacco after CO
2 sublimation caused by the manual regulation of the frequency converter in the metering belt, the control system was modified based on PLC technology. Taking the travel distance from tobacco inlet to outlet of the metering belt as a control cycle, the weight of tobacco on the belt was determined by the difference of tobacco weight in the vibrating hoper in a control cycle; the throughput of dry ice impregnated tobacco was automatically controlled via empirically setting the throughput value, calculating the operating frequency of the belt within a control cycle and modifying the frequency control program. The expanded tobacco for cigarette brand A was tested in Guangzhou Cigarette Factory, the results showed that the incidence and duration that tobacco throughput exceeded the standard value after CO
2 sublimation decreased by about 0.56 times/h and 175.04 s/h respectively, the range and standard deviation of moisture content in tobacco reduced by 0.27 and 0.027 percentage points respectively. The consistency of tobacco throughput and moisture content in tobacco was effectively promoted. This technology provides a support for improving the intrinsic quality of expanded tobacco.
